President Nicusor Dan has referred the matter to the Constitutional Court
Articol de Radiojurnal, 20 Noiembrie 2025, 18:57
President Nicusor Dan has referred the matter to the Constitutional Court regarding the law approving the emergency ordinance introducing a new Single Electronic Register of Communicable Diseases.
In a Facebook post, the head of state points out that the law provides for the storage of all medical and personal data for the entire life of the person and for at least 180 days after death, without the right to request their deletion.
The president considers this to be a disproportionate interference in private life, contrary to Article 26 of the Constitution.
The document uses unclear terms, does not distinguish between those who have a reporting obligation and those who can access the data, and leaves essential issues to secondary administrative acts, Nicusor Dan further argues.
